Fixed `list->weak-vector'.
* libguile/vectors.c (scm_i_allocate_weak_vector): Removed. (MAKE_WEAK_VECTOR): New macro. (allocate_weak_vector): New. (scm_i_make_weak_vector): New. (scm_i_make_weak_vector_from_list): New. * libguile/vectors.h: Updated. * libguile/weaks.c (scm_make_weak_vector): Use `scm_i_make_weak_vector ()'. (scm_weak_vector): Use `scm_i_make_weak_vector_from_list ()'. git-archimport-id: lcourtes@laas.fr--2005-libre/guile-core--boehm-gc--1.9--patch-13
